2017-06-08 5 views
1

Authentifizieren Durch TraefikWie würde man Authentifizierung mit Traefik nähern? Anfragen

Ich betrachte mit traefik als Proxy für einen Satz ein Microservices.

Allerdings erkannte ich, dass Traefik einen Authentifizierungsmechanismus wie den von Kong nicht unterstützt.

Ich möchte Verbraucher mit Traefik registrieren und Zugriff basierend auf Authentifizierung ermöglichen.

Gibt es einen empfohlenen Ansatz dafür?

Idealerweise möchte ich alle eingehenden Anfragen an einen Dienst weiterleiten, der die eingehende Anfrage authentifiziert. Ich kann jedoch keine Möglichkeit finden, dies mit Traefik zu tun, indem ich eine benutzerdefinierte Middleware verwende.

Kurz gesagt, gibt es eine Möglichkeit, eine solche Middleware zu Traefik hinzuzufügen und eine Fernprüfung durchführen zu lassen, bevor eine Anforderung übergeben wird?

(Der Grund Auth um traefik gebaut sind sehr begrenzt.)

Antwort

1

Ich glaube nicht, Traefik dies unterstützt derzeit. Verwenden Sie eine Service Discovery-Schicht hinter Traefik wie Consul/Kubernetes Ingress? Wenn dies der Fall ist, können diese Dienste ACL access für Dienste unterstützen.

Verwandte Themen